When using this option, an empty output.library will result in a broken output bundle. The only placeholders allowed here are [id] and [hash], the default being: Typically you don't need to change output.hotUpdateChunkFilename. libraryTarget: 'global' - The return value of your entry point will be assigned to the global object using the output.library value.
By setting the mode parameter to either development, production or none, you can enable webpack's built-in optimizations that correspond to each environment. It will only work through a RequireJS compatible asynchronous module loader through the actual path to that file, so in this case, the output.path and output.filename may become important for this particular setup if these are exposed directly on the server.
The callback function name used by webpack for loading of chunks in Web Workers. In the bundle itself, it is the output of the function that is generated by webpack from the entry point.
The value of the option is prefixed to every URL created by the runtime or loaders. In our browser, if we browse to http://localhost:4000/ we’ll see our web app: Let’s make a change to the heading that is rendered in index.tsx. Learn more about JavaScript modules and webpack modules here. You can provide a non-crypto hash function for performance reasons. It is the main file which will import all other required files. Let’s create the configuration file containing the following: So, we have configured ESLint to use the TypeScript parser, and the standard React and TypeScript rules as a base set of rules.
If you want to support older browsers, you will need to load a polyfill before using these expressions. This bundle will not work as expected, or not work at all (in the case of the almond loader) if loaded directly with a